Μηχανισμός ειδοποίησης για ασφαλή χρήση κούνιας

Μηχανισμός ειδοποίησης για ασφαλή χρήση κούνιας

Η ομάδα μας
σχεδίασε και κατασκεύασε ένα μηχανισμό με arduino που θα ελέγχει πόσο ψηλά μπορεί να πηγαίνει μια κούνια σε παιδική χαρά για λόγους ασφαλείας.
Υπάρχουν 3 κουμπιά για να επιλέγει ο χρήστης το επίπεδο δυσκολίας και ένα επιπλέον κουμπί που ενεργοποιεί/απενεργοποιεί ηχητική προειδοποίηση.

https://www.tinkercad.com/things/cwuCP1XuEIM-gwnia-koynias

Θα χρησιμοποιήσουμε:
Χρήση αισθητήρα γωνίας (π.χ. γυροσκόπιο/επιταχυνσιόμετρο – MPU6050) για να μετράει την κλίση της κούνιας και να περιορίζει την ταλάντωση.
Χρήση αισθητήρα απόστασης (π.χ. υπερήχων HC-SR04 ή LiDAR) για να μετράει το ύψος που φτάνει η κούνια.

Led που θα ανάβει όταν ξεπεράσουμε το όριο
Buzzer  για ηχητική ειδοποίηση
Οθόνη LCD για ενδείξεις
Χρήση κινητήρα με έλεγχο τάσης/δύναμης που θα περιορίζει την ώθηση αν ξεπεραστεί το επιλεγμένο όριο.
Ρύθμιση Δυσκολίας (Με τα 3 Κουμπιά)
Υπάρχουν 3 κουμπιά που επιλέγουν διαφορετικά όρια ύψους:
Εύκολο → Μικρό εύρος ταλάντωσης (~20°)
Μεσαίο → Μέτριο εύρος ταλάντωσης (~35°)
Δύσκολο → Μεγάλο εύρος ταλάντωσης (~50°)

Το αποθετήριο του έργου είναι στη διεύθυνση: https://github.com/gerasbo/oscillation